    Hines Ward - WR, Pittsburgh Steelers 11/22/2006

    Pittsburgh WR Hines Ward (hyper-extended knee) is listed as questionable for the Steelers game at Baltimore on Sunday, but he said that he expects to play.

    Mike Bell - RB, Denver Broncos 11/22/2006

    Denver's top two running backs, Tatum Bell (toe) and Mike Bell (thigh), are both listed as questionable for the Broncos' Thanksgiving Day tilt against Kansas City, but head coach Mike Shanahan said that Tatum Bell will get the start if he's healthy.

    Tony Gonzalez - TE, Kansas City Chiefs 11/21/2006

    Kansas City Chiefs tight end Tony Gonzalez (shoulder) practiced on Tuesday, November 21st, and is expected to play in the late game on Thanksgiving Day between the Broncos and Chiefs.

    Antonio Bryant - WR, San Francisco 49ers 11/21/2006

    San Francisco 49ers wide receiver Antonio Bryant was arrested Monday morning, November 20th, for suspicion of drunken driving, resisting arrest and speeding over 100 mph. He spent four hours in jail and is scheduled to be arraigned on Thursday, December 28th. This latest infraction is likely to draw a punishment from the NFL. "We are aware of the off-field situation concerning Antonio," 49ers spokesman Aaron Salkin said. "Due to the nature of the event, the 49ers are withholding further comment at this time."

    Ronnie Brown - RB, Miami Dolphins 11/21/2006

    Miami Dolphins running back Ronnie Brown (groin) appears ready to start on Thanksgiving Day against the Detroit Lions, after only receiving 12 carries in week eleven against the Vikings. Head coach Nick Saban said Brown was "no worse for the wear from playing" Week 11.
